Can Ground News Reliable? A Critical Examination
Ground News strives to differentiate itself by presenting news from a wider range of sources than many mainstream channels, highlighting media bias scores to offer a more complete perspective. However, determining its reliability necessitates a more extensive look. While the idea of surfacing diverse viewpoints is praiseworthy, the methodology behind Ground News’ bias assessment has been faced to scrutiny. Some analysts argue that the algorithm used to determine bias can be difficult to understand and potentially affected by subjective understandings. Ultimately, Ground News should be viewed as a resource for exploring different perspectives, but not as a definitive or unbiased source of information itself, necessitating users to use critical thinking and compare information with other credible sources.

Ground News: Cutting Through News Slant – Might It Deliver?
With growing concerns regarding one-sided coverage in mainstream media, Ground News has emerged as an initiative to present a more balanced view of current events. The platform aggregates articles from a wide range of publications, then scores them based on their perceived slant. But, does this novel approach actually deliver on its commitment of reducing ideological effect? Some observers propose that assigning a bias score is inherently individual, and that Ground News’s approach can misrepresent complex matters. Despite these potential flaws, Ground News remains a compelling tool for people seeking to increase their understanding of the globe and challenge their own preconceptions about what's happening.
